Ingredients for Cherry Berry On A Cloud
- 6 large egg whites
- Cream Of Tartar
- Pinch of salt
- 1 cup granulated sugar + 1/2 cup powdered sugar
- 8 ounces softened cream cheese
- 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
- 1 cup whipped heavy cream
- Mini Marshmallows
- 1 (21 ounce) can cherry pie filling
- Fresh Strawberries

How to Make Cherry Berry On A Cloud
- Preheat oven to 275°F (135°C). Grease a 9x13 inch baking pan.
- In a clean, grease-free bowl, beat 6 large egg whites until soft peaks form. Gradually add 1 cup of granulated sugar, 1 teaspoon cream of tartar, and a pinch of salt, beating until stiff, glossy peaks form.
- Pour the meringue into the prepared pan and spread evenly.
- Bake for 60 minutes. Turn off the oven and leave the meringue in the oven overnight with the door slightly ajar.
- The next morning, prepare the filling: In a mixing bowl, beat together 8 ounces of softened cream cheese, 1/2 cup powdered sugar, and 1 teaspoon vanilla extract until smooth.
- Gently fold in 1 cup of whipped heavy cream and 1 cup of mini marshmallows.
- Spread the cream cheese mixture evenly over the cooled meringue.
- Refrigerate for at least 12 hours, or preferably overnight.
- Before serving, top with 1 (21 ounce) can cherry pie filling and 1 cup sliced fresh strawberries.
